tjmurphy wrote:That's a dandy, Jerry. These old CAMILLUS scout/utility knives are way under-rated. ::tu::
The thing that amazes me is the handles. Even though they are that black synthetic they used back then, they have not shrunk or curled. They are just as tight as the day the knife was made. In my book, that's a head shaker.

It has one defect. The punch blade will not close all the way with the master blade closed. It get's hung up on the liner and with the master closed, you can not push it over far enough to complete closing. Master closes fine with the punch closed. ::shrug::
